Summary
Overview
Work History
Education
Skills
Accomplishments
Certification
Timeline
Generic

RAVI SINGH

Senior Mobile Developer
Dubai

Summary

A highly skilled Senior Android Developer with extensive experience in designing and developing high-quality mobile applications. Adept at using modern Android technologies like Kotlin, Java, and Jetpack Compose, with strong expertise in MVVM, MVP, and Clean Architecture. Proven ability to work collaboratively with cross-functional teams to deliver secure,
user-friendly, and high-performance digital solutions.

Overview

9
9
years of professional experience
1
1
Certification

Work History

Senior Developer

Nielsen
12.2022 - Current
  • Developed Nielsen Android SDK to measure audience watching behaviour in video and audio consumption patterns.
  • Completed event generation module for user behaviour monitoring during video playback, enhancing reporting capabilities.
  • Engineered Flutter-based Android bridge for seamless SDK integration without modifying native SDK layers, simplifying distribution for Flutter platform.
  • Revamped CI/CD pipeline on GitLab, establishing workflows for nightly automation report generation and single-click deployment across multiple distribution flavors.

Senior Consultant

Quinnox Consultancy Services Limited
12.2020 - 12.2022
  • Collaborated with US waste management firm to re-organize and enhance Driver Assist Android app, achieving streamlined UI and improved performance.
  • Integrated HERE Map for optimised truck navigation, enhancing performance and user experience.
  • Conducted thorough testing and debugging processes to ensure app reliability across diverse devices.
  • Implemented Agile methodologies to improve project workflow and team collaboration.

Senior Android Developer

Cirrius Technologies Private Limited
03.2018 - 12.2020
  • Collaborated with cross-functional teams to deliver high availability solutions for mission-critical applications.
  • Developed and maintained Phyzii Mobile 2.3, a multi-language CRM application, ensuring secure API integration with Retrofit.
  • Created Phyzii Tab app for digital product showcases, incorporating doctor monitoring and tracking features.
  • Implemented coding best practices to enhance app performance and maintainability.
  • Engaged in agile methodologies, facilitating effective sprint planning and retrospectives, improving team efficiency.

Android Developer

Nevon Solution Private Limited
03.2017 - 03.2018
  • Managed all aspects of Android app lifecycle from research and planning through deployment and post- launch support.
  • Gained expertise incorporating offline storage, performance tuning and threading into apps for seamless use.
  • Worked on projects like Nevon GPS Tracker and Nevon Express as a in-house product for managing & tracking logistics with Nevon GPS & e-commerce for electronics & electrical devices.

Junior Android Developer

Volga Infotech Private Limited
06.2016 - 03.2017
  • Worked on development of E-Commerce ADS [Aishwarya Design Studio] application from scratch, Involved in different screens designing to API integration, also also integrated PAYPAL payment gateway as well.
  • Beauty Button is the second application worked in facial structure wise doctor recommended different cosmetics products. Here worked on custom camera module for image capturing to image processing module with custom features.

Education

Bachelor of Engineering - Computer Engineering

St. John College of Engineering

MBA: Master of Information Management - undefined

Thakur Institute of Management Studies

Skills

Android SDK

JAVA

KOTLIN

Firebase

SQLite

Jetpack Components [Databinding, LiveData, ViewModel, Room, Lifecycles, Work Manager, Lean Back,etc]

Design Pattern [MVC, MVVM]

Version Control [Git, SVN]

Web Services [Volley, Retrofit]

Payment Gateway [PayPal, EBS,CCavenue]

Languages

English

Superior

Hindi

Native

Marathi

Advanced

API

English

Gateway

JAVA

MVC

Research

Accomplishments


  • Self Developed application

All in One Scanner - PDF Converter [https://play.google.com/store/apps/details?id=com.rpoolapps.allinonescanner ].

Certification

Certified Scrum Master

Timeline

Senior Developer

Nielsen
12.2022 - Current

Certified Scrum Master

07-2022

Senior Consultant

Quinnox Consultancy Services Limited
12.2020 - 12.2022

Senior Android Developer

Cirrius Technologies Private Limited
03.2018 - 12.2020

Android Developer

Nevon Solution Private Limited
03.2017 - 03.2018

Junior Android Developer

Volga Infotech Private Limited
06.2016 - 03.2017

Bachelor of Engineering - Computer Engineering

St. John College of Engineering

MBA: Master of Information Management - undefined

Thakur Institute of Management Studies
RAVI SINGHSenior Mobile Developer